
Sillimanian Archers Qualify for PH National Youth Team in PSC–WAP Selection Event

Three student-athletes from Silliman University secured spots in the Philippine National Youth Archery Team after strong performances in the 2026 PSC–WAP National Team and National Youth Team Selection Event held January 27 to February 1, 2026 at the STI Gold Toe Archery Center in Marikina City.
Grade 12 student Naina Dominique Tagle ranked second in the Recurve Women Category, while Gabrielle Monica Bidaure, a fourth-year BS Psychology student, finished third in the same division. Meanwhile, Davayn Philip Mason, a Grade 9 student, secured Rank 4 in the Recurve Under-18 Men Category, earning a berth in the National Youth Team.
The national selection event, organized by the Philippine Sports Commission (PSC) in partnership with World Archery Philippines (WAP), gathered around 84 Filipino archers competing in recurve and compound divisions across different age groups, including Under-18, Under-21, and senior categories.
Serving as the official qualifying tournament for athletes aspiring to represent the country internationally, the competition determines members of the Philippine National Archery Team and National Youth Team for upcoming regional and global tournaments, including the SEA Games, Asian Games, and other World Archery events.
